Compression Socks Benefits

Compression socks aren't just a fashion statement; they're a game-changer for your overall well-being. Here are some key benefits of wearing compression socks:

  • Improve Blood Circulation: Compression socks apply gentle pressure to your legs, helping to improve blood circulation. By promoting the efficient flow of blood back to your heart, compression socks can reduce the risk of blood pooling in your lower limbs and enhance oxygen delivery to your muscles.
  • Reduce Leg Swelling and Fatigue: Whether you're standing all day at work or sitting for long periods of time, swelling and fatigue in your legs are normal. Compression socks provide focused compression, which reduces edema and prevents fluid accumulation in your legs.
  • Prevent varicose veins and deep vein thrombosis (DVT): Varicose veins and deep vein thrombosis (DVT) are serious medical conditions characterized by poor blood circulation and clotting in the legs. Compression socks provide pressure on the walls of your veins, preventing them from stretching and bulging, which cause varicoses. Furthermore, compression socks help increase blood flow and reduce the risk of blood clots, lowering the likelihood of DVT.

By incorporating compression socks into your daily routine, you can enjoy these benefits and more, ensuring optimal leg health and comfort in any situation. Care Instructions

To maintain the quality and durability of your compression socks, follow these care instructions:

  • Machine wash: Wash your compression socks in cold water (less than 30°C) with comparable colors. Use a mild detergent to guarantee thorough washing while maintaining the fabric's integrity.
  • Air dry: After washing your socks, lay them flat or hang them to dry naturally. Avoid using a dryer since high temperatures might damage elastane fibers and impair compression efficacy over time.
  • Avoid bleaching: Bleach can deteriorate the fabric and reduce the socks' compression advantages.
  • No ironing: Avoid ironing your compression socks since high heat might reduce the material's flexibility.
  • Avoid tumble drying: Tumble drying can potentially harm the fabric and shorten the life of your compression socks. Choose air drying instead.
